1. Weight loss

Excessive weight loss occurred without the obedience of weight, like exercise or diet. If you experience weight loss for no reason, we recommend you go to the doctor to check it.

According to the American Cancer socienty (ACS), among other medical problems such as parasites or an overactive thyroid, weight loss can not be explained, a sign of cancer of the stomach, esophagus, pancreas or lungs.

2. Fever

Fever can help you to fight off infections. However, if the fever is ongoing, may show symptoms of cancer such as non-Hodgkin's lymphoma. If your body temperature reaches 103 degrees F or higher, you should immediately check.

According to the National Cancer Institute, other symptoms of non-Hodgkin's lymphoma that is losing weight, berkeringan at night, coughing, and swelling of the lymph nodes.

3. Problems swallowing

If you have trouble swallowing continuously, immediately examine it. It can be caused by acid reflux or it could be a sign of cancer of the esophagus, throat or stomach.

4. hoarseness and cough

Voice suddenly hoarse and coughing would not stop? It is advisable to immediately seek medical help. Hoarseness can be a symptom of cancer of the larynx or thyroid gland, and annoying cough can be a symptom of lung cancer.

5. skin wounds that never healed

If you notice a mole that changes, check with your doctor for fear it is a symptom of skin cancer. Other skin changes, including changes in pigment, red visible skin changes, such as freckles, moles or warts, can also be an early symptom of skin cancer.

6. Tired continuously

If your body does not feel fresh after waking up at night, you should be wary. Fatigue that would not go away can be an early symptom of leukemia, colon cancer or stomach cancer.
